Horse Leaders and Side Walkers

Riders in our program have specific goals that they work on during their sessions. These goals may include improvements in their balance, posture, muscle tone, speech, social skills and self-esteem. Certified instructors lead the lessons and trained volunteers are needed to assist each rider by leading the rider's horse (horse leader) and/or walking next to the rider (side walker) throughout the lesson.

Barn Assistant Our barn and equine managers works hard

every day to keep our horses fed, watered and exercised. The horses' stalls are cleaned every morning. The horses' turn-out areas or paddocks are also cleaned regularly when temperatures above freezing permit it. The Barn Manager trains volunteers as barn Assistants to help with barn chores in the mornings during the week. Daily chores are sometimes affected by weather but include stall mucking, water-bucket cleaning, throwing down hay from the hayloft and sweeping the barn aisle.

Office Assistant We like to stay in contact with our riders

and our volunteers and we do a number of mailings throughout the year. We often need an office volunteers to help us with mailings and flyers. If you like to work with computers, you can help us with data input and form design. We will gladly provide you with on the job training for any work you do in our office.
